After a wait of several minutes there was another beep as the Assistance Chip finished its first scan and configuration. It then projected all of Savani's basic attributes into his mind.
According to his studies Savani found that this world had broken up a persons body into several different attributes from years of research and experimentation. These results were found after hundreds of thousands of years of research done by the Sages in an attempt to better understand how to gain more power as well as help their descendants. These attributes could be categorized into five different types: Strength, Physique, Vitality, Agility, and Spirit. These five attributes would determine an apprentices and an Adepts strengths and weaknesses.
Strength was primarily used to quantify a persons physical strength and was the most important attribute for close combat Sages, otherwise known as Warrior Sages. This attribute would determine ones base damage when using close combat techniques, both bare handed and with a weapon. It also affected ones explosiveness and accuracy when dealing with close combat. An ordinary commoners Strength would be capped at 5, with the average being around 3.
Physique represented a persons endurance and fortitude. With a high physique one could have a stronger body and be able to withstand various forms of harm like poison or diseases. It would also improve a persons stamina allowing them to last longer in battle so it was concidered a very important attribute. Most humans only had a Physique of 2 or 3.
Vitality represented a persons life force. In essence this was how hard it was to kill a person as well as how quickly they could recover from damage. A person with a high Vitality could recover from injuries far faster than those with a low Vitality. A person with high Vitality could also withstand far more injuries than one with low Vitality making it a very sought after attribute. This attribute for a normal person was a 2 showing how weak a normal person truely was.
Agility represented a bodys dexterity, speed, reflexes, balance, and flexibility. This attribute was vital for those who focused more on fast paced combat. Those with a high Agility prefered light or medium armor and tended to a more quick footed fighting style. Agility was also very important to those who used long ranged weapons so it was also sought after by bow users. Usually a commoners agility was around a 3.

Spirit determined a persons learning ability as well as their capability at holding essence. This attribute was the most important for Sages as it decided on the number of spells they could use while in battle as well as make it easier for them to understand newer spells. A higher Spirit could also augment the power of a spell allowing the spell to be far more deadly. This attribute was also the reason there were so few Sages and apprentices around.
An average animal would have a spirit of 1 or 2, while for humans it would be normaly around 3. However to become an apprentice the minimum Spirit attribute was 5! And to evolve to a Sage an apprentice must gather over 20 Spirit!
*Beep*
[Host name: Savani
Race: Human (beginner apprentice)
Affinities: Darkness, Space
Attributes: Strength: 2.91 Physique: 3.02 Vitality: 2.14 Agility: 2.46 Spirit: 5.04
Status: Healthy
Skills: Magic Language Proficiency (Basic)
Spells: None]
Glancing at his status Savani sat up straight in shock! Space affinity!? From what he could gather apprentices could only get in touch with the most basic of elements. Namely those of Earth, Water, Wind, Fire, Light, and Darkness. From these elements, along with some external stimulus and modification, is how Sages developed more complex elemental affinities.
For instance if a Sage wanted to develop an affinity with plants he would need to develop an affinity for both Earth and Water, with a smaller affinity with either Light or Darkness depending on the type of plant life he wished to attune with. And even then the Sage would have to start with one of these affinities and slowly augment their body while they were an apprentice before reaching the point of being able to control the desired type of plant life.
However unlike other apprentices he seemed to gain access to a higher tier element at the very beginning! The chances of this happening were so rare that most magical organizations didnt even test for them. Only the bigger organizations that stretched over hundreds of smaller ones would waste resources to look for all elemental affinities on a mere beginner apprentice.
Of course there were those who were born with a high affinity with a higher tier element in which case the testing orb would show that element, but if there were more than one element it would only show those that were the most basic.

Still reeling from the shock Savani looked at the rest of his status. Overall they were fairly average which made sense since a fresh apprentice wasn't allowed to start their journey until after the first months training. They weren't even given any form of meditation until the time they picked their first spell module. This was to help the apprentice get a small foundation and not rush into things they didn't understand.
The fact that he had two elements, and one being a higher tier element made the road he could travel far grander than if he only had one element.
From his studies Savani learned there were mainly four ways for an apprentice to become a Sage. They were Body Modification, Elemental Baptism, Bloodline Modification, and Soul Transference.
Body Modification was the path of augmenting the apprentices body with various external stimuli. Some Body Modification Sages used metals and plants to augment their bodies while others used monster organs. Some even went so far as to turn themselves into undead! These bodies could handle a stronger Spirit allowing them to break through the wall between that of an apprentice and a full blown Sage. However they were severely limited by their augmentations and would have to be very careful to leave room for them to augment themselves down the line or they could find that their journey would come to an end.
Elemental Baptism was the path of attuning ones body and soul with a particular element. Due to this their body could handle greater stress from the element the Sage was attuned to. Not only that but the cost of spells from that element would be reduced while their strength would be increased. They could also absorb that one element far easier than they could before their baptism. The tradeoff though would be that elements opposed to this would hurt them twice as much while also stripping the wielder of the ability to wield other elements.
Bloodline Modification was similar to Body Modification. It used the blood of magical creatures to boost and mutate the Sage into a hybrid style human. These Sages could weild multiple elements as well as usually have high physical attributes allowing them to be quite strong. They could also sometimes gain abilities unique to the creature whose blood they fused with. However there was a major trade off. The blood would modify the Sages body into a hybrid, sometimes deforming them into monsters. The Sages mood would also be affected by the bloodline making them irritable and tempermental which was a large problem as a Sage was suppose to remain clear headed to better learn magic and understand the laws governing it. But the biggest problem is that the Sage would be bound to the rank that the creature could grow to! If they hybridized with a creature that could only become a low level Sage then that is as far as they would ever go on their journey.
The final road a Sage could take was Soul Transference. This road was similar to Bloodline Modification except instead of modifying their own body the Sage would transfer their soul into the body of a creature or construct. There they would grow until they reached the peak of their bodies capabilities. Whats more the body that they transfered into would have to be that of an infant or egg to properly allow the Sage to keep their conciousness while binding to the foreign body. Otherwise they could find their soul and memories devoured by the creatures and instead allow the creature to benefit.
With a sigh Savani looked at the book he was origionally reading before closing it and heading to bed. Tomorrow he would be given his first spell and meditation technique and he needed a clear mind to help him determine what to choose. Before heading to sleep though, he sent a message to the chip to sort all knowledge gathered over the last month in his memories into different categories and to start extrapolating an appropriate plan to maximize his growth.
